What is the immediate impact of the recent surge in Chinese open-source AI model releases on the global AI landscape?
In just weeks, multiple Chinese firms released advanced open-source AI models like Zhipu.AI's GLM-4.5, Alibaba's Qwen3, and Moonshot AI's Kimi K2, each showcasing unique capabilities in reasoning, coding, and agent tasks. These models are rapidly improving and readily available, accelerating global AI development.

Framing Bias

The article is framed to highlight the success and rapid advancement of Chinese AI models. The positive tone, use of quotes praising Chinese models, and emphasis on the number of models released from China all contribute to a narrative that presents China in a highly favorable light. Headlines and introductory paragraphs are structured to showcase Chinese achievements.

3/5

Language Bias

The article uses overwhelmingly positive language when describing Chinese AI models, employing words and phrases like "dazzling debut," "unabated fervor," "vast innovation potential," "rivaling or even surpassing," and "enduring creative vitality." While these are descriptive, they lean towards celebratory rather than neutral reporting. More neutral alternatives could include phrases like "significant advancements," "rapid development," and "competitive models." The use of quotes from researchers and industry leaders also contributes to a positive framing but are not presented as biased in themselves.

3/5

Bias by Omission

The article focuses heavily on the advancements of Chinese AI models and largely omits discussion of comparable advancements from other countries. While it mentions OpenAI and Claude, the comparison is limited and doesn't provide a balanced overview of global progress. The omission of detailed comparisons with non-Chinese models could lead readers to overestimate China's dominance in the field.
